Well the weather was crappy here for fishing, but a friend of mine was dead set on going somewhere and wetting a line today. The wind was blowing a good 15-20 knots today out of the north north east, so we were able to get about 2-3 miles offshore in his bay boat before it got real bumpy. We started off the day trolling hoping to pick up a few spanish macks, but ended up catching the biggest redfish I have ever caught in my life. i've seen a few this size before, but did not expect to catch this trolling a medium sized spoon through bait pods off the beach. He was released alive and kicking much to one of my buddies dislike as he was well outside of the 18-27" slot limit we have here in Florida. We didn't keep him out of the water long enough but to take a few pics then dunk him back to revive him and release. Didn't catch another fish all day myself, but I did land one monster redfish. Took me every bit of 20 minutes on a 17 pound spinning rod set-up(kingfish rig). We guestimated him to be about 36-38 inches and every bit of 20 pounds.
